Wednesday's decision of the Monetary Policy Council to reduce interest rates will be beneficial from the point of view of the Polish economy – said the Minister of Finance Andrzej Domański on Friday. He also assured that access to cash is very important and must remain.


Minister of Finance Andrzej Domański was asked on Friday on TVN 24 about the Wednesday decision of the Republic of Poland to reduce interest rates by 25 points of databases. “This is a fairly common view that the conditions to reduce interest rates in Poland are very good – we have falling inflation,” said Domański. At the same time, he reminded that, according to the forecasts of his ministry in July, inflation would be 3 percent, “that is, very close to the NBP goal.”
“Is I enjoying this decision? Yes. I think that it will be beneficial from the point of view of the Polish economy, from the point of view of accelerating credit, from the point of view of Poles' abilities to make purchases” – added the minister.
The head of the Ministry of Finance was also asked about the words of the NBP president Adam Glapiński, who argued on Thursday that cash should stay in circulation, because “cash is freedom”. “From the very beginning, I emphasize that cash, access to cash is very important and must remain” – emphasized Domański.
At the same time, he assessed that in his opinion “this is a bit of scaring from some political parties, that we will limit access to cash.” “There are no such plans, there are no such intentions,” he assured.
“We all pay with cards, telephones, gadgets with which you can pay. And this is a trend, we see him in Poland, we see him in the world that these non -cash transactions gain importance. At the same time, cash must stay; has an element of freedom, some anonymity when it comes to payment, which for some is associated with freedom,” he added.
Domański was also asked about the so -called “windmill act”, freezing energy prices. The minister expressed the hope that President Andrzej Duda would seriously treat the interest of millions of Polish families and sign the law. ” “We will do absolutely everything so that energy prices are not only at the level, which is currently frozen, but even lower,” he assured.

The Monetary Policy Council (RPP) on Wednesday at the end of the two -day meeting decided to lower interest rates by 25 base points. The Council's decision means that the main interest rate and reference rates have decreased to 5 percent. on an annual basis. The lombard rate will be 5.50 percent on an annual scale, deposit rate 4.50 percent, 5.05 percent bills of exchange rates, and the discount rate of the bills of exchange 5.10 percent. on an annual basis.
According to the assumptions of monetary policy developed by the MPC, the goal of the NBP is to maintain inflation – understood as a percentage annual change in the price index of consumer goods and services – at 2.5 percent. with a symmetrical compartment of +/- percentage width in the medium period.
Last week, the Sejm adopted an amendment to the so -called windmill law, which, among others It reduces the minimum distance of wind turbines from buildings to 500 m. The Act also includes provisions on freezing energy prices by the end of the year at the level of PLN 500 net per MWh. Currently, freezing is valid until the end of September this year.
The amendment liberalizes the regulations regarding the construction of wind farms, including Also introducing the so -called Participatory Fund for the inhabitants of the neighborhood of future wind farms. During the second reading in the Sejm, the Polish 2050 amendment was introduced into the project, providing for the extension of freezing electricity prices for households for the fourth quarter of 2025. In accordance with current regulations, the price is frozen at the level of PLN 500 per MWH net MWh is valid until September 30. The Senate must still take care of the law. (PAP)
